About Johanna Kling

Johanna Kling is a scholar working on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ology, Applied Psychology and Clinical Psychology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 356 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Eating Disorders and Behaviors (9 papers), Body Image and Dysmorphia Studies (8 papers) and Digital Mental Health Interventions (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acy (65 citations), Clinical Psychology (250 citations) and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ology (12 citations). Johanna Kling has collaborated with scholars based in Norway, Sweden and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Ann Frisén, Maria Wängqvist, Sofia Berne, Rachel F. Rodgers, Linda Kwakkenbos, Phillippa C. Diedrichs, Barbara Dooley, Nichola Rumsey, Anabela G. Silva and Maria Piedade Brandão. Their work appears in journals such as Developmental Psychology, Journal of Experimental Child Psychology and Body Image.
